City approves joining state wildfire response program

MCPHERSON, Kan. — The McPherson City Commission unanimously approved an agreement with the Kansas Office of the State Fire Marshal to add the McPherson Fire Department to the state wildfire response program. Under the contract, which runs for a multi-year term, the city agrees to potentially deploy a brush truck, a command vehicle and three personnel to assist with wildfires across the state. Fire Chief Chad Mayberry told commissioners the program is fully reimbursed by the state and functions similarly to a mutual aid agreement, allowing the department to decline a call or cancel the agreement if local resources are stretched too thin.
